In this interview, Technical Officer I – Biodiversity at the Environmental Management Authority, Rishi Deosaran, discusses the significance of World Wildlife Day, observed annually on March 3rd.
Focusing on this year’s theme, “Medicinal and Aromatic Plants: Conserving Health, Heritage and Livelihoods,” Rishi highlights how wildlife and biodiversity support health, cultural heritage, and local livelihoods in Trinidad and Tobago.
He explains the threats facing plant and animal species, the role of the Environmental Management Authority in their protection, and practical steps communities can take to promote sustainable use, while reflecting on the broader cultural and ecological importance of respecting and conserving the nation’s natural heritage.
